Cauliflower and broccoli bake

Time needed:
Yields: 4 servings
Calories: 374 kcal / serving

Ingredients:

  • 1 small cauliflower head
  • salt
  • 250 ml milk
  • 400-500 g broccoli
  • 40 g butter
  • 40 g flour
  • white peppers
  • nutmeg, grated
  • pinch curry (optional)
  • 150 g cheese, grated
  • 2 eggs
  • butter for coating the baking form

Directions:

  • Clean cauliflower, wash and put in to the salted water for 10 minutes.
  • Boil water with milk, salt to taste, put cauliflower florets and boil a few minutes. Let cool.
  • Repeat everything with broccoli, just boil 6 minutes.
  • Melt butter in a pan, pour flour and heat. Then mix in milk. Season with salt, peppers, nutmeg and curry. In medium heat boil for 8 minutes.
  • Then mix in 100 g of cheese and take off from the heat.
  • Heat oven to 200°C.
  • Coat baking dish with butter.
  • Put in to it cauliflower and broccoli florets.
  • Beat into the cheese sauce eggs, mix and pour over the vegetables. Sprinkle with the left cheese and bake about 25 minutes or till the top will brown nicely.
  • Enjoy!

Source: Renata Kissel. Apkepai
